1. Bitcoin (BTC)

This is a borderless digital asset that is as dependable as it gets, seeing as how it has the ability to resist censorship from any government in control. It is the most advanced cryptocurrency on the market, and acts as a hedge against inflation, as it is decentralzed and doesn’t fall under the control of central banks.

Bitcoin (BTC)

Countries employ diverging monetary policies, which make it all the more necessary to use bitcoin as a neutral settlement for overseas transactions. This makes the cryptocurrency and its immediate convinience a must for any investor, which increases BTC value and makes it a great investement.

- Advertisement -

Bitcoin(BTC) Features

  • Decentralization: Functions independently of central banks, allowing for borderless liquidity.
  • Scarcity: Bitcoin’s supply is capped at 21 million, making it inherently deflationary.
  • Mobility: Can be transferred cross-border without friction.
  • Institutional Participation: Members of the sector are offering payment processing services, and ETF offerings.

2. Gold

Gold has been humanity’s ultimate store of value for millennia, and in a multi-polar world, it retains unmatched credibility. It hedges against inflation, geopolitical risk, and fiat currency volatility.

Gold

Across Asia, Europe, and the Middle Eastern central banks accumulate reserves. This further cements gold’s strategic importance. Gold’s universal acceptance makes it a safe haven asset, bridging trust among competing blocs.

Owned in various forms, gold serves to diversify, enhance stability, and protect for most imbalances, which is why it is a central pillar for most gold imbalances.

Gold Features

  • Store of Value: A universal and cross-culturally accepted asset.
  • Inflation Hedge: Debasement of fiat currencies has a direct adverse effect on gold.
  • Central Bank’s Gold Reserves: Gold is routinely and strategically acquired by central banks all over the world.
  • Liquidity: Gold is one of the most liquid assets worldwide.

3. Productive Real Estate

Income-generating real estate, be it commercial, farmland, or logistics hubs, provides real security in uncertain times. Unlike speculative properties, productive real estate continues to generate cash flow, and protect against inflation for the investor.

Productive Real Estate

In a multi-polar economy, demand for most housing, warehousing and agricultural land is still strong across most regions.

- Advertisement -

Productive real estate provides a hedge against currency volatility, as the rental receipts and land value tend to increase with inflation. Capital profit and cash flow provides security against most geopolitical and monetary shifts which makes it a desirable asset.

Productive Real Estate Features

  • Cash Flow Generation: Real estate generates passive income through rent collection.
  • Inflation Protection: In an inflationary environment, land and by extension, real estate rises in value.
  • Tangible Asset: Owing a real asset is inherently safe.
  • Versatility: Real estate includes residential, agricultural, and warehouse properties.

5. AAA Sovereign Bonds

High quality, AAA-rated sovereign bonds from countries such as Germany, Switzerland, and Singapore guarantee peace of mind during uncertain times. These bonds provide predictably low returns and no risk of default, with the added benefit of safe haven protection during times of political crisis.

AAA Sovereign Bonds

In a multi-polar economy, where emerging markets are often volatile, AAA sovereign bonds provide portfolios with trust, liquidity, and a safe anchor.

They also balance out risk from more volatile investments such as equities and commodities. Most investors including those looking for long term resilience and diversification, will consider bonds a key investment for global fragmentation.

Sovereign Bonds from AAA-Rated Countries

  • Safety: Bonds from AAA-rated countries hold no default risk.
  • Predictable Returns: Bonds yield guaranteed income via interest payments.
  • Liquidity: As with most assets, bonds are tradeable.
  • Portfolio Anchor: Provides stability while other investments are more volatile.
